hugetlb: do early cow when page pinned on src mm
This is the last missing piece of the COW-during-fork effort when there're pinned pages found. One can reference 70e806e4e645 ("mm: Do early cow for pinned pages during fork() for ptes", 2020-09-27) for more information, since we do similar things here rather than pte this time, but just for hugetlb. Note that after Jason's recent work on 57efa1fe5957 ("mm/gup: prevent gup_fast from racing with COW during fork", 2020-12-15) which is safer and easier to understand, we're safe now within the whole copy_page_range() against gup-fast, we don't need the wr-protect trick that proposed in 70e806e4e645 anymore.
